Abstract
The invention relates to high-rise escape equipment, in particular to high-rise escape equipment which can make people leave a stricken floor quickly, start a floating system fast and safely control an escape line. The high-rise escape equipment consists of a launching device, a quickly started floating device, a punt-pole-shaped moving line device and a fan-shaped moving line control device. By the use of the high-rise escape equipment, a preparation stage that a survivor escapes from a room to the outdoor air with part of the equipment, and a floating escape stage that the survivor safely moves to a safe place with the carried equipment in the outdoor air are experienced in sequence.

Background technology
For the resident family of high-rise building, during breaking out of fire, how as early as possible escape is one of problem needing careful consideration.Occur in " 911 " of the U.S., causing a tremendous loss of lives with huge property loss is exactly an exemplary.Conventional fire in high buildings rescues four kinds of means to be had: find comparatively safe place and wait for that fire terminates; Aerial ladder is utilized to rescue; Utilize earth's surface air cushion or buffer unit escape; Helicopter is utilized to rescue; The unpowered flight such as parachute, aerodone device is utilized to escape voluntarily; The buoyant device such as fire balloon, dirigible is utilized to escape.
If the intensity of a fire is comparatively large, disaster-stricken building is residential building and floor is very high, and also have some other high building near floor, so, existing four kinds of disaster relief means are all difficult to prove effective.Wherein, the reason that the buoyant device such as fire balloon, dirigible is difficult to prove effective starts comparatively slowly, takes up an area larger.
Existing product and technology are difficult to provide one can leave disaster-stricken floor fast, start floating system fast, the approach of security control escape route.

The scheme that the present invention adopts is:
The use of high building escape equipment successively experiences the preparatory stage---and survivor carries equipment component and runs away to the aerial of outdoor indoor, and the device security that floating escape stage---survivor carries in the aerial utilization of outdoor moves to safety place.
High building escape equipment forms by with lower part:
A catapult-launching gear can be the spring pad with high elastic coefficient; In the preparatory stage, survivor carries and starts flotation gear, long punt-pole shape moving line device and fan shape moving route control device fast and utilize catapult-launching gear to jump out from window, balcony etc. are open or escape from fast, and away from high building exterior wall, arrive open aerial, to obtain the usage space starting flotation gear fast; One starts flotation gear fast, is the light balloon that can fold, can be full of light gas fast, possess light gas turnover control valve; After arriving outdoor clearing, survivor can complete startup fast by starting flotation gear fast, makes survivor obtain climbing power, and provides adjustable climbing power in the whole escape stage; A long punt-pole shape moving line device, being a leptosomatic rod-like device, can be a long punt-pole; In the floating escape stage, long punt-pole shape moving line device is used for avoiding survivor and starting flotation gear fast near any dangerous building or other aerial device; A fan shape moving route control device is one can, as the fan-shaped device of sail and fan, can be a large fan; In the floating escape stage, fan shape moving route control device utilizes air force to provide horizontal power for survivor and the quick flotation gear that starts, and adjusts escape route.
The invention has the beneficial effects as follows:
1, it is aerial that survivor can utilize catapult-launching gear to make survivor and necessaries rapidly move to open outdoor, and the person that makes high-rise life saving can start needs the light balloon of large quantity space to escape.2, lift can be obtained in the air in comparatively safe outdoor rapidly, and keep suitable lift, survivor can be escaped from high building exterior.3, can by controlling the vertical motion of survivor and lightweight balloon to the control starting flotation gear fast, the horizontal movement of survivor and lightweight balloon can be adjusted by fan shape moving route control device, and the accident collision in escape process can be avoided by long punt-pole shape moving line device, by above-mentioned three kinds of motion control methods, survivor's safety movement can be made to safety place.4, operation is simple, do not need to spend great effort in advance to learn.
